test(webapp): browser-level cross-origin session-stream e2e

Adds a real-Chromium leg to the session-stream e2e: a page on a different
origin than the webapp cross-origin fetches and streams the session `.out`
through the proxy, exercising the browser CORS preflight and streaming read
that a node-fetch client skips. Runs against the same testcontainer stack.

@@ -0,0 +1,123 @@
/**
* Browser-level session-stream e2e.
*
* Same full stack as session-stream.e2e.test.ts, but the client is a real
* Chromium page on a DIFFERENT origin than the webapp, driven via
* page.evaluate. It exercises what node-fetch can't: a real browser doing a
* cross-origin fetch + streaming read of the session `.out` SSE through the
* webapp proxy, so the browser enforces the CORS preflight + response headers
* the customer scenario depends on (a frontend on its own origin subscribing
* to the API). The webapp runs production-mode here, so this checks the
* production CORS path, not the dev-server one.
*
* Requires a pre-built webapp (pnpm run build --filter webapp) and Chromium
* (pnpm exec playwright install chromium).
*/
import { randomBytes } from "crypto";
import { createServer, type Server } from "http";
import { chromium, type Browser } from "@playwright/test";
import { afterAll, beforeAll, describe, expect, it, vi } from "vitest";
import type { SessionStreamTestServer } from "@internal/testcontainers/webapp";
import { startSessionStreamTestServer } from "@internal/testcontainers/webapp";
import { seedTestEnvironment } from "./helpers/seedTestEnvironment";
import {
mintSessionToken,
SessionStreamProducer,
sessionStreamName,
} from "./helpers/sessionStream";
vi.setConfig({ testTimeout: 120_000, hookTimeout: 240_000 });
let server: SessionStreamTestServer;
let browser: Browser;
let origin: Server;
let originUrl: string;
beforeAll(async () => {
server = await startSessionStreamTestServer();
browser = await chromium.launch();
origin = createServer((_req, res) => {
res.writeHead(200, { "content-type": "text/html" });
res.end("<!doctype html><html><body>origin</body></html>");
});
await new Promise<void>((resolve) => origin.listen(0, "127.0.0.1", () => resolve()));
const addr = origin.address();
const port = typeof addr === "object" && addr ? addr.port : 0;
originUrl = `http://127.0.0.1:${port}`;
}, 240_000);
afterAll(async () => {
await browser?.close().catch(() => {});
await new Promise<void>((resolve) => (origin ? origin.close(() => resolve()) : resolve()));
await server?.stop();
}, 120_000);
describe("session stream browser e2e", () => {
it("EB1: a cross-origin browser subscribes to .out and streams records", async () => {
const { organization, environment, apiKey } = await seedTestEnvironment(server.prisma);
const addressingKey = `sess-${randomBytes(6).toString("hex")}`;
const token = await mintSessionToken({ apiKey, envId: environment.id, addressingKey });
const streamName = sessionStreamName({
orgId: organization.id,
envSlug: environment.slug,
envId: environment.id,
addressingKey,
});
const producer = new SessionStreamProducer({
endpoint: server.s2.endpoint,
basin: server.s2.basin,
streamName,
});
await producer.appendData({ n: 0 }, "p0");
await producer.appendData({ n: 1 }, "p1");
await producer.appendTurnComplete();
const sseUrl = `${server.webapp.baseUrl}/realtime/v1/sessions/${encodeURIComponent(
addressingKey
)}/out`;
const page = await browser.newPage();
try {
await page.goto(originUrl);
const result = await page.evaluate(
async ({ url, token }) => {
const ac = new AbortController();
try {
const res = await fetch(url, {
headers: { Authorization: `Bearer ${token}`, Accept: "text/event-stream" },
signal: ac.signal,
});
const reader = (res.body as ReadableStream<Uint8Array>).getReader();
const decoder = new TextDecoder();
let text = "";
const deadline = Date.now() + 8000;
while (Date.now() < deadline) {
const { done, value } = await reader.read();
if (done) break;
text += decoder.decode(value, { stream: true });
if (text.includes('"records"')) break;
}
ac.abort();
return {
ok: res.ok,
status: res.status,
sawBatch: text.includes('"records"'),
pageOrigin: location.origin,
};
} catch (e) {
return { error: String(e) };
}
},
{ url: sseUrl, token }
);
expect("error" in result ? result.error : undefined).toBeUndefined();
expect(result).toMatchObject({ ok: true, status: 200, sawBatch: true });
expect((result as { pageOrigin: string }).pageOrigin).toBe(originUrl);
expect(originUrl).not.toBe(server.webapp.baseUrl);
} finally {
await page.close();
}
});
});
